1

Step 1

JUnit

2

Step 2

Java Core

3

Step 3

Exceptions

4

Step 4

Collections

5

Step 5

Multithreading

6

Step 6

JDBC

7

Step 7

XML

8

Step 8

JMS

9

Step 9

Spring

10

Step 10

Hibernate

11

Step 11

Servlets, JSP

12

Step 12

Design Patterns

13

Step 13

Core Oracle

14

Step 14

SQL

15

Step 15

UNIX/shell

16

Step 16

Maven

17

Step 17

XLST

18

Step 18

Android API

19

Step 19

TomCat

20

Step 20

Oracle Java Certified Associate SE8

21

Step 21

English Upper-Intermediate

1

Step 1

JUnit

2

Step 2

Java Core

3

Step 3

Exceptions

4

Step 4

Collections

5

Step 5

Multithreading

6

Step 6

JDBC

7

Step 7

XML

8

Step 8

JMS

9

Step 9

Spring

10

Step 10

Hibernate

11

Step 11

Servlets, JSP

12

Step 12

Design Patterns

13

Step 13

Core Oracle

14

Step 14

SQL

15

Step 15

UNIX/shell

16

Step 16

Maven

17

Step 17

XLST

18

Step 18

Android API

19

Step 19

TomCat

20

Step 20

Oracle Java Certified Associate SE8

21

Step 21

English Upper-Intermediate

05 April 2016 01 October 2016
Goal completed 17 May 2016

Goal author

Career & Work

Java Junior Developer

Начал искать себя, и долго не мог найти то, что мне понравится очень сильно. Но в марте 2015 года пересекся с товарищем приехавшим в наш родной город на сессию и он посоветовал курс java-rush. С этого и понеслось. Периодически забивая на учебу, и отвлекаясь, как сам, так и по жизненным обстоятельствам, решил все же дойти до конца и получить, что я желаю уже в течении года. Не думаю, что это будет легко, тем более придется поднимать уровень английского, но я верю в себя и цель через полгода устроится на работу junior developer'ом по ява или андройд мне кажется реальной. Ну в общем-то и все, let's go=)

 Goal Accomplishment Criteria

job-offer Java Junior Developer

 Personal resources

Официальная документация, Экель "Философия Ява", Хорстманн "Java2. Библиотека профессионала", HeadFirst "Паттерны проектирования", "Алгоритмы на Java", HeadFirst Android, Основы SQL, прочие книги, курс "Java Rush", курс "CodeAcademy"

  1. JUnit

    Разобрать написание тестов в JUnit

  2. Java Core

    1. Введение в ООП

    2. Примитивные типы, аргументы и прочее

    3. Операторы

    4. Управляющие конструкции

    5. Инициализация и завершение

    6. Управление доступом

    7. Повторное использование

    8. Полиморфизм и наследование

    9. Интерфейсы, абстрактные классы

    10. Внутренние классы

    11. Строки

    12. Обобщенные типы

    13. Массивы

    14. Ввод/вывод

    15. Аннотации

    16. Swing

  3. Exceptions

  4. Collections

    1. Queue

    2. List

    3. Set

    4. Map

  5. Multithreading

  6. JDBC

  7. XML

  8. JMS

  9. Spring

    Beans, MVC, DAO, AOP

  10. Hibernate

  11. Servlets, JSP

  12. Design Patterns

  13. Core Oracle

  14. SQL

    За основу взял "SQL полное руководство" Грофф, Вайнберг, Оппель.

    Планирую расматривать на postgreSQL, LiteSQL.

    На данный момент прописанные этапы не считаю полными, по мере продвижения буду дополнять.

    1. Простые запросы

    2. Многотабличные запросы

    3. Итоговые запросы, подзапросы и выражения с запросами

    4. Обновление данных

    5. Обработка транзакций

    6. Создание баз данных и представления

    7. SQL и безопастность

  15. UNIX/shell

  16. Maven

  17. XLST

  18. Android API

  19. TomCat

  20. Oracle Java Certified Associate SE8

    Первичная сертификация оракл на java-developer

    1. Составить список тем для сертификации

    2. Скачать тестовые вопросы для сертификации

    3. Накопить 150 долларов + перелет в Москву и проживание в течении суток

    4. Зарегистрироваться на сертификацию и пройти

  21. English Upper-Intermediate

    Есть шутка: "Не знаете какой язык программирования учить - учите английский".

    Зачастую требования в вакансиях от интермедиэйта. Да и по прочтению успешных историй одно из главных требований - английский язык. Так что надо поднимать.

  • 1899
  • 05 April 2016, 10:18
Sign up

Signup

Уже зарегистрированы?
Quick sign-up through social networks.
Sign in

Sign in.
Allowed.

Not registered yet?
 
Log in through social networks
Forgot your password?